Understanding Quantum Computing
Quantum computing is a burgeoning area of technology that leverages the principles of quantum mechanics to perform computations at unprecedented speeds. Unlike classical computers that use bits as the smallest unit of data (0s and 1s), quantum computers utilize quantum bits, or qubits. Qubits can exist in multiple states simultaneously, thanks to the phenomenon known as superposition, allowing quantum computers to process complex calculations more efficiently than their classical counterparts.
The Intersection of Quantum Computing and Blockchain
Blockchain technology serves as a decentralized ledger for recording transactions and data in a secure, public manner. This technology relies heavily on cryptography to ensure the integrity and security of transactions. The convergence of quantum computing and blockchain networks presents both challenges and opportunities, as quantum advancements could significantly impact the cryptographic methods sustaining blockchain security.
Quantum Threats to Blockchain Security
Vulnerabilities in Cryptographic Protocols
Currently, most blockchain systems utilize classical cryptographic algorithms like SHA-256 and ECDSA (Elliptic Curve Digital Signature Algorithm) to secure data and validate transactions. However, with the advent of quantum computing, these algorithms may be rendered obsolete. Quantum computers can employ Shor’s algorithm to effectively break widely used cryptographic keys, compromising the blockchain’s integrity. The theoretical capabilities of a sufficiently powerful quantum computer could allow it to factor large integers and solve discrete logarithm problems in polynomial time.
The Risk of Quantum Attacks
Quantum attacks could pose significant risks to blockchain networks, particularly if they enable adversaries to forge transactions or reverse previously confirmed transactions. This would undermine the cryptographic foundations of trust essential to blockchain ecosystems. As researchers predict an increasing development of quantum technology, the time frame for blockchain networks to adapt is limited.
Opportunities Offered by Quantum Computing
Enhanced Security Protocols
While quantum computing presents challenges, it also offers new opportunities for security enhancement. Quantum Key Distribution (QKD) utilizes the principles of quantum mechanics to create encryption keys that are theoretically immune to interception. This technology could significantly bolster blockchain security by eliminating the risk of key compromise through eavesdropping.
Improved Performance and Efficiency
Beyond security, quantum computing’s efficiency could help improve blockchain technology through faster transaction verification and processing times. Smart contracts and decentralized applications (dApps) executed on blockchain could also benefit from superior computational power, enabling more complex algorithms and data processing capabilities. Quantum-enhanced algorithms could enhance the consensus mechanisms in blockchain networks, like Proof of Work and Proof of Stake.
Quantum-Resistant Blockchain Solutions
In light of the potential threats posed by quantum computing, a proactive approach has emerged within the blockchain community: the development of quantum-resistant blockchain protocols. These systems integrate cryptographic algorithms designed to withstand quantum attacks, ensuring the long-term security and viability of blockchain networks.
Post-Quantum Cryptography
Post-quantum cryptography refers to cryptographic systems that are secure against the capabilities of quantum computers. Research organizations, including NIST, are actively working on standardizing post-quantum algorithms. These algorithms can be implemented within blockchain networks to safeguard transaction data from potential quantum threats.
Hybrid Models
Some blockchain projects are exploring hybrid models that incorporate both classical and quantum-resistant cryptographic techniques. Such models aim to provide a gradual transition, allowing blockchain developers to enhance security while still leveraging existing infrastructure.
Key Blockchain Projects Addressing Quantum Risks
-
Quantum Resistant Ledger (QRL): This project specifically focuses on creating a blockchain that is resistant to quantum computing threats by utilizing hash-based signatures. Its development aims to secure data against both classical and quantum attacks.
-
IOTA: IOTA is investigating post-quantum security measures to protect its Tangle network, employing quantum-resistant algorithms to preempt potential vulnerabilities.
-
Chainlink: As a decentralized oracle network, Chainlink is developing ways to integrate quantum-safe cryptographic elements to ensure the integrity of data feeds and smart contracts.
The Future Outlook
The relationship between quantum computing and blockchain is an evolving landscape. As quantum technology matures, the need for blockchain networks to adapt becomes increasingly crucial. Embracing quantum-resistant cryptographic measures will be essential to protect existing assets and ensure the overall sustainability of the blockchain ecosystem.
Collaborative Solutions
A robust strategy to address the implications of quantum computing involves collaborative efforts across industries. Blockchain developers, quantum researchers, and cybersecurity experts must engage in productive discussions to identify vulnerabilities and formulate effective solutions.
Regulatory and Compliance Challenges
The intersection of quantum computing and blockchain also brings forth regulatory concerns. Governments and regulatory bodies may find it challenging to establish a framework that adequately addresses the unique security concerns posed by quantum computing while fostering innovation within the blockchain space.
Final Thoughts
QR codes, biometric verification methods, and decentralized identity are just a few examples of innovative approaches being adopted as a part of the evolution of blockchain technology in light of quantum computing advancements. As quantum computing continues to develop, it will be essential for blockchain networks to integrate advanced cryptographic measures, maximizing security and maintaining user trust in this critical digital infrastructure.
The Need for Vigilance and Preparedness
As quantum computing evolves, vigilance and preparatory measures will be crucial for the blockchain community. The best defense against imminent threats involves staying informed about quantum developments while concurrently refining blockchain technology to remain resilient and secure in an increasingly complex digital landscape.
By remaining adaptive and proactive, blockchain networks can continue to thrive and serve their intended purpose as trusted decentralized systems for various applications worldwide.
As organizations and individuals consider the potential quantum realities confronting blockchain today, proactive engagement and investment in research, development, and collaboration are vital. Only through a concerted effort can the crypto community harness the promise of quantum technology while safeguarding the integrity and future of blockchain systems.
